This nutritious chicken and broccoli quinoa bowl combines lean protein, vibrant vegetables, and wholesome grains for a balanced meal. It’s an excellent option for lunch or dinner, packed with flavor and health benefits.
The recipe is simple to prepare and can be customized with your favorite seasonings or additional vegetables. It’s perfect for meal prep or a quick weeknight dinner.
Ingredients That Shine
This chicken and broccoli quinoa bowl is a delightful blend of wholesome ingredients.
At its core, the dish features diced chicken breast, which provides lean protein essential for muscle repair and overall health.
Bright green broccoli florets add a pop of color and are packed with vitamins and minerals, making them a nutritious choice.
Fluffy quinoa serves as the perfect base, offering a gluten-free grain that is high in protein and fiber.
To enhance the flavors, olive oil, garlic, and a hint of paprika are included, creating a savory profile that complements the freshness of the vegetables.
Preparation Made Simple
Preparing this dish is straightforward and efficient, taking only about 30 minutes from start to finish.
Begin by cooking the quinoa in chicken broth or water, allowing it to absorb all the flavors.
While the quinoa cooks, sauté the diced chicken in olive oil until it’s golden brown and fully cooked.
Adding minced garlic and broccoli to the skillet infuses the dish with aromatic notes, while the broccoli retains its vibrant color and crunch.

Healthy Chicken and Broccoli Quinoa Recipe

This dish features tender chicken breast cooked with fresh broccoli and served over fluffy quinoa. The recipe takes about 30 minutes from start to finish and serves 4 people.
Ingredients
- 1 cup quinoa, rinsed
- 2 cups chicken broth or water
- 1 lb chicken breast, diced
- 2 cups broccoli florets
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on salt, adjust to taste
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ce or tamari (optional)
- Chopped green onions for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Cook Quinoa: In a medium saucepan, combine quinoa and chicken broth or water.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es or until liquid is absorbed. Fluff with a fork and set aside.
- Sauté Chicken: In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add diced chicken, season with salt, pepper, and paprika, and cook until browned and cooked through (about 5-7 minutes).
- Add Broccoli: Stir in the minced garlic and broccoli florets. Cook for an additional 5 minutes, or until the broccoli is tender but still bright green.
- Combine: Add the cooked quinoa to the skillet with the chicken and broccoli. Stir to combine and heat through. If desired, drizzle with soy sauce or tamari for added flavor.
- Serve: Divide the quinoa mixture into bowls and garnish with chopped green onions if using. Serve warm.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Servings: 4 bowls
- Calories: 350kcal
- Fat: 10g
- Protein: 30g
- Carbohydrates: 40g
